🛠How to Add Clickable Ads to Your Blogger Sidebar
You can place clickable ads in your sidebar using two easy methods:
🔹 Method 1: Add AdSense Ads to Sidebar
If you're already approved for Google AdSense, follow this method.
Step-by-Step:
-
Go to Blogger Dashboard
-
Click on “Layout”
-
Find the Sidebar section
-
Click “Add a Gadget”
-
Choose “AdSense”
-
Pick your ad format (square, rectangle, etc.)
-
Save it
Blogger will automatically show AdSense ads in the sidebar, based on your content and visitor location.
✅ These are clickable by default and AdSense-compliant.

📌 Ad Sizes That Work Best in Sidebars
Some ad sizes fit better than others in a sidebar. Here are the most popular:
Size | Description |
---|---|
300x250 | Medium Rectangle (most used) |
300x600 | Large Skyscraper (very visible) |
160x600 | Slim Skyscraper |
336x280 | Large Rectangle |
💡 Keep mobile users in mind: sidebar ads mostly show on desktop.
🧠Tips to Make Clickable Ads More Effective
-
Place ads near the top
-
The higher the ad, the more views it gets.
-
-
Use eye-catching images
-
Bright, clear images attract more clicks.
-
-
Avoid clutter
-
Don’t put too many ads in the sidebar. 1–2 is enough.
-
-
Label clearly
-
For affiliate banners, you can write “Advertisement” above the ad.
-
-
Check links regularly
-
Make sure the ad still works and the product is still live.
-
❌ Mistakes to Avoid
-
Using low-quality or blurry images
-
Linking to spammy or adult websites (this will get you banned)
-
Overloading your sidebar with too many ads
-
Adding clickable ads before getting AdSense approval
-
Using misleading images or fake "download now" buttons
✅ Always follow AdSense policies to stay safe.
